During the Brindleford incident we saw the dedup ring buffer saturate at roughly 4,200 alerts/minute, well above the 1,800/minute we provisioned for. Hash-window collisions stayed under 0.3%, but suppression latency crept past 900 ms once memory pressure triggered eviction. If you're paged for dedup lag, check heap headroom before scaling horizontally — a single oversized window usually explains it. We've re-derived the defaults from the last quarter's traffic percentiles. The constants below reflect those revised assumptions.

tuning table, kajog-kawef:
PRIORITIES = {
    "kelox": 870,
    "kasix": 89,
    "eliax": 988,
}

## Deployment: Timezone Handling

Report exports from Ledgerpine are rendered in the tenant's configured timezone, not the server's. The export workers normalize everything to UTC internally and convert only at render time. If a tenant has no timezone set, the fallback zone applies — this is the usual culprit when on-call gets "wrong date on report" pages. After deploying, verify the worker picked up the zone database bundle. The relevant deployment settings are listed below.

deployment values, taweg-bajop:
[fenvan]
port = 5672
team = holmir
host = fenvan.orvexio.example
region = lower-1
access_code = ac_b98bc6
timeout_ms = 1500

Subject: Handover — Larkspur health checks

Hey Dorin,

Quick handover before I'm out. The Brindlegate load balancer is still flagging two Larkspur nodes as unhealthy even though they serve fine — it's the /pulse endpoint timing out under 2s, not a real outage. I bumped the check interval to 10s on node-east; do the same on node-west if it flaps again tonight. Rollback steps are in the usual runbook. To push the config, you'll need the deploy key right here.

signing key of bagap-yawep = bky13_TbfT6ZMUoGJo2

## Releases

The Brellan billing worker uses blue-green deploys. Each release spins up the green pool, replays a sampled hour of invoices against it, and compares totals before traffic shifts. Maintainers should never force a cutover while reconciliation is running. All worker images must be signed prior to promotion, using the deploy key shown directly below.

release key, fajef-kajeg: bky19_LdLu6Ne6FLi8he2c24d